Course Content

• Synthesis and Characterization of Nanoparticles
• Nanomaterials for Drug Delivery (Targeted Drug Delivery, Liposomes, Micelles)
• Toxicology and Biodistribution of Nanoparticles
• Biomedical Imaging with Nanoparticles (MRI, CT, Optical Imaging)
• Nanoparticles in Theranostics
• Nanobiotechnology and Regenerative Medicine
• Advanced Microscopy Techniques for Nanoparticle Analysis
• Regulatory Aspects of Nanoparticle-Based Therapies

A Postgraduate Certificate in Nanoparticles Biomedical Applications provides specialized training in the synthesis, characterization, and biomedical applications of nanoparticles. This intensive program equips students with the knowledge and skills necessary to contribute to this rapidly advancing field.


Learning outcomes typically include a comprehensive understanding of nanoparticle properties (size, shape, surface chemistry), various synthesis techniques (e.g., sol-gel, microemulsion), advanced characterization methods (TEM, SEM, DLS), and the application of nanoparticles in drug delivery, diagnostics, and regenerative medicine. Students will also develop crucial skills in data analysis, research methodology, and scientific communication.
